Payroll Specialist -
Seeking to join a successful well known organization. The Payroll Specialist will need to ensure the timely and accurate delivery of payroll, including record keeping and reporting. The Payroll administrator will be responsible for and not limited to: - Manage time and attendance work flow to ensure all time sheets, time off requests, and other payroll documents are received timely and are accurate, complete and in compliance with state and federal payroll standards. Follow-up with supervisors and managers on any missing or incomplete documentation. Ensure final records are archived per standard operating procedures. - Set-up and pay garnishments in compliance with respective authorities. - Respond to all Federal, State, and other agency requests for compliance documentation (wage orders, garnishments, tax levies, etc.) Ideal candidate must have 5+ years• experience processing multi-state payroll, preferably in transportation industry, strong knowledge of federal and state regulations and ability to deal sensitively with confidential material. Knowledge of HR Labor info and high volume experience is a HUGE PLUS!
